Your Opportunity


BDO Canada’s London‑Windsor group of offices are looking for Senior Accountants to join our Assurance team. This is a replacement role where the successful candidate will own the following responsibilities:



  • Lead audit engagements, prepare working papers, and compile financial statements, all in line with regulatory standards.

  • Streamline year‑end engagements and prepare tax returns for clients across a variety of industries.

  • Build and maintain positive relationships with clients, and address their needs and suggestions promptly.

  • Contribute to business development and identify opportunities with existing clients.

  • Keep your team in the loop on progress and potential issues, fostering a collaborative environment.

Your Experience and Education



  • You’re a CPA, or working towards your CPA designation, with at least 3 years of experience in external audit in the public accounting sector.

  • You have a strong understanding of accounting standards and regulations.

  • You are highly detail‑oriented and demonstrate excellent time‑management skills with the ability to handle multiple engagements simultaneously.

  • You are proactive in seeking out professional development opportunities to enhance your skills and knowledge.

  • You have strong problem‑solving, analytical, and communication skills.


The expected range of compensation for this role is: $62,000 to $96,000
